Transaction 139471cc598616731314aa5df0361cc161a299924d5e875a70e5b0f83f68cde7

2 Input
2 Outputs
  • 139471cc598616731314aa5df0361cc161a299924d5e875a70e5b0f83f68cde7:0
  • value  202587
    address  3GZ6H47xHkRychxduXavYuxq2X7m1DNLUv
  • 139471cc598616731314aa5df0361cc161a299924d5e875a70e5b0f83f68cde7:1
  • value  76800
    address  bc1qxz6m3ns5j2xrddshl9v02ncmlh78vemzmdc0x6